Before I go any further, I wanna introduce myself. My name is Gor Galstyan. This year is my senior year at UAA, and let me tell you, I couldn't be more excited. For some people it takes only 4 year to graduate, but it's gonna take 5 years for me, since I had to take whole bunch of ESL classes in my first year of college.

I came to Alaska as an exchange student in 2006, and stayed here for one academic year. At that time, I was a high school student attending South Anchorage High School. After my school year, my host mother asked me if I wanted to come back to Alaska and go to UAA, and if I did, she said it would be okay if i stayed with them the whole time I am in college, that way being able to save lots of money on room and board, and of course I agreed and to this day I am still living with my host family, who have become like my own family during these past five years.
 

In this blog, I am mainly going to represent the UAA Campus Bookstore, where I currently work. Actually, this was my first job when i was hired in 2008, and I am still working here 'til this day. SOME of my coworkers are pretty fun and the job gets pretty exciting most of the time. I have met lots of new people and made new friends.
